body{min-width: 1200px;}
.w1200{width: 1200px;}
.header,.header_inner{height: 140px;background: #fff;}
.header .logo{

}
.header .logo h1{
    font-size:32px;
    font-family:'Microsoft YaHei';
    font-weight:bold;
    color:rgba(35,49,79,1);
    /*
    background:linear-gradient(0deg,rgba(84,131,179,1) 0%, rgba(6,62,119,1) 48.583984375%, rgba(84,131,179,1) 49.609375%, rgba(6,62,119,1) 88.5009765625%);
    */
    -webkit-background-clip:text;
    -webkit-text-fill-color:transparent;
    line-height: 140px;
}
.header .logo h3{
    font-size:16px;
    font-family:Arial;
    font-weight:400;
    color:rgba(6,62,119,1);
}
.header .search_top{
    margin-right: 102px;
    margin-top:40px ;
}.header .search_top .top_phone{
    margin-top: 3px;
 }
.header .search_top .top_phone span{
 color: #666666;font-size: 14px;
    display: inline-block;
    line-height: 30px;
    vertical-align: top;
}
.header .search_top .top_phone span.phone_number{
    color: #063E77;font-size: 20px;
}
.header .search{
    width:215px;
    height:32px;
    line-height: 32px;
    border:1px solid #ebebeb;
    border-radius:16px;
    color: #CACACA;
    font-size: 12px;
    padding: 0 15px;

}
.header .search input{
    line-height: 32px;
    border: none;
    outline: none;
    width: 195px;
    height: 32px;
    padding: 0;
}
.header .search .search_btn{
    width: 18px;
    height: 32px;
    background: url("../image/search_btn.png") no-repeat 0 center;
    cursor: pointer;
}
.header .nav{
    right: 0px;
    bottom: 0;
}
.header .nav ul li{
    float: left;
    margin-left: 20px;
    /*min-width: 72px;*/
    text-align: center;
    line-height: 38px;
}

.header .nav ul li.active{
    color: #063E77;
    border-bottom: 2px solid #063E77;
    background: url("../image/blueicon.png" ) center bottom no-repeat;
}
.header .nav ul li:hover a,.header .nav ul li.active a{
    color: #063E77;
}

.header .nav ul li a{
    color: #111;
    font-size: 18px;
}
.header .toplogin{
    right: 0px;
    top:59px;
}
.header .toplogin a{
    color: #111;
    font-size: 16px;
    padding-left: 5px;
}
.header .toplogin a.zc{  background: url("../image/linesm_001.png") no-repeat left center;padding-left: 8px;margin-left: 5px;}
/*个人中心*/
.login-after{position: absolute;right: -56px;top: 53px;}
.login-after p img{margin:5px 5px 0 0;}
.login-after .headlogin a{cursor: pointer;background: url('../image/icondown.png') no-repeat right center;
    padding-right:20px;overflow: hidden;text-overflow: ellipsis;
    white-space: nowrap;width:65px;display: inline-block;}
.login-after .headlogin a.bjshow{background: url('../image/iconup.png') no-repeat right center;}
.headlogin{width:116px;height:35px;padding:0 10px;line-height: 35px;}
.head-border{box-shadow:0px 1px 10px #e5e5e5;-moz-box-shadow:0px 1px 10px #e5e5e5;
    -webkit-box-shadow:0px 1px 10px #e5e5e5;background:#fff;}
.login-after .header-ul{width: 116px;position: absolute;padding:0 10px;
    top:0;background:#fff;z-index: 9999;-moz-box-shadow:0px 4px 10px #e5e5e5;
    -webkit-box-shadow:0px 4px 10px #e5e5e5;box-shadow:0px 4px 10px #e5e5e5;display: none;margin-top: 35px;box-shadow-top:none;:}
.login-after .header-ul ul li{width:100%;height:32px;line-height: 32px;text-align: center;
    margin-right: inherit;}
.login-after .header-ul ul li a{color: #333;font-size: 12px;}
.header-ul ul li.last a{display: inline-block;border-top:1px dashed #ccc;width:50%;}
.login-after .header-ul ul li a:hover{color:#063E77!important;text-decoration: underline}
/*footer*/
.footer{
    height: 290px;
    background: #333;
}
.footer ul{width: 788px}
.footer ul li{
    float: left;
   padding: 0 45px;
  border-right: 1px solid #ddd;
  height:88px;}
.footer ul li.last{border: none
}
.footer ul li h1{
    font-size:20px;
    font-family:'Source Han Sans CN';
    font-weight:400;
    color:#fff;
}
.footer ul li  p{
    margin-top: 5px;
}
.footer ul li  p a{
    font-size:14px;
    font-family:'SimSun';
    font-weight:400;
    color:rgba(255,255,255,1);

}
.footer ul li  p a:hover{
    color:rgba(230,127,19,1)!important;
}
.footer ul li  h3{
    font-family:'Source Han Sans CN';
    font-weight:400;
    color:#fff;
    margin-top: 2px}
.footer .wd{color: #fff;
   font-size: 14px;
font-family: ' SimSun ';
}
/*覆盖融学css*/
a:hover,.friendly-link ul li a:hover,.common-problem-content ul li a:hover,.rightmain ul li a:hover
{color: #063E77!important;}
.classification-menu{padding-top: 0px!important;}
.titlecolor, .morecolor, .navul li.active a, .img1.active a, .img2.active .fxcolor, .img3.active a, .img4.active a, .img5.active a, .navactive li.active a, .audition-chapter ul li.current a, .audition-chapter ul li.current span, .details-content ul li a.text:hover, .share-div ul li a:hover, .share-div ul li span:hover {
    color: #063E77!important;
}
.whj_jqueryPaginationCss-1 .whj_checked, .whj_jqueryPaginationCss-1 .whj_hover:hover{
    background: #063E77!important;
}
.bluebj,.registration-information ul li.active, .community-wrap .nav ul li.active, .course-nav-list h3 a.active, .details-content ul li:hover a.button, .loginbtn-banner button:hover {
    background: #063E77!important;
}
.registration-text p {background: url(../image/zc-left_07.png) no-repeat right center!important;}
.registration-text .last{background: none!important;}
.information-box{padding-top: 0px!important;}
.details-main{margin-top:0px!important;}
.border-public {border: 1px solid #da3752!important;}
.details-bg{padding-top: 30px;}
.search input[type="text"]:hover{border: none;box-shadow: none;}
.lefttab ul li.active{background-color: rgba(253, 240, 242, 0.6);border-left:8px solid  #DC0021;padding-right: 8px }
.lefttab ul li.active a{color:#DC0021;font-weight: bold;}
.lefttab ul li a{text-align: center;display: block;}
/*.lefttab ul li.active a:hover,a.bluebtn:hover,.bluebj:hover,a.border-public:hover{color: #DC0021!important;}*/
.audition-chapter ul li.current a,.audition-chapter ul li.current span,.audition-chapter ul li.current a:hover{color: #23b8ff!important}
.audition-chapter ul li a:hover{color: #b6d2ef!important;}

/*新修改*/
.navWarp_box{}
.navWarp_28{width:100%;height: 38px;background: #063E77;}
.navWarp_28 .nav_inner_28{margin-left: 23px;}
.navWarp_28 .nav_inner_28 li{float: left;text-align: center;margin-right: 10px;}
.navWarp_28 .nav_inner_28 li a{display: inline-block;line-height: 38px;padding: 0 24px;color: #fff;font-size: 16px;}
.navWarp_28 .nav_inner_28 li a:hover{color:#FE9704!important;}
.navWarp_28 .nav_inner_28 li a.active{background: #E67F13;}
.navWarp_28 .nav_inner_28 li a.active:hover{color:#fff!important;}
.appLoad_main{width: 326px;height: 215px;background: url("../image/appbox_bg.png") no-repeat 0 0;position: absolute;top: 38px;
    right: -102px;display: none;z-index: 99999999;}
.appLoad_main h1{margin-top: 12px;color: #262626;font-size: 14px;}
.appLoad_main dl{width: 256px; margin: 14px auto}
.appLoad_main dl dd{width: 142px;}
.navWarp_28 .nav_inner_28 .appLoad_main dl dd a{display: block;padding:0 0 0 36px;height: 36px;line-height: 36px;color: #fff;
    font-size: 12px;border-radius: 20px;width: 96px;text-align: left}
.appLoad_main dl dd a.android{background:url("../image/Android_icon.png") no-repeat 14px center #063E77;margin: 8px 0 10px;}
.navWarp_28 .nav_inner_28 .appLoad_main dl dd a:hover{color: #fff!important;}
.appLoad_main dl dd a.iphone{background:url("../image/iphone_icon.png") no-repeat 14px center #E67F13;}
.appLoad_main dl dd p{font-size: 12px;color: #4D555D;}
.join_jg{
    margin-right: 23px;
    position: relative;
}
.join_jg p{background: url("../image/jigou_icon.png") no-repeat 0 center;padding-left: 22px;}
.join_jg p a{font-size: 16px;background: url("../image/up_sm.png") no-repeat right center;line-height: 38px;color: #fff;
    padding-right: 14px;cursor: pointer;}
.join_jg p a:hover{color:#fff!important;}
.join_jg ul{
    padding:  6px 0;
    background:#fff;
    box-shadow:0px 0px 5px 1px rgba(0, 0, 0, 0.11);
    display: none;z-index: 999999999;
    position: absolute;
    left: 0;
    top: 36px;
    width: 100%;
}
.join_jg li a{font-size: 14px;color: #787D82;display: inline-block;text-align: center;height: 40px;line-height: 40px;width: 100%;}
.join_jg li a:hover {background: #ECECEC;color:#787D82!important; }
